Which of the following shall be a part of a REQUIRED fall protection system in a hoist area when an employee has to lean out over the edge of the opening to receive or guide equipment or materials through?
A fall arrest system is a required part of a fall protection system in a hoist area.
A fall arrest system is essential for preventing injuries when an employee leans out over the edge of an opening to receive or guide equipment or materials, as it effectively stops a fall before the employee can hit the ground.
A control line is typically used to delineate a safe working area and does not provide physical protection against falls. While it can aid in maintaining awareness of fall hazards, it does not physically stop an employee from falling, making it inadequate as a required fall protection measure in this scenario.
A fall arrest system is specifically designed to safely stop a fall in progress. It includes components such as harnesses and lanyards, which are critical when employees are exposed to fall risks while leaning over edges. This system is mandated to ensure the safety of employees working in potentially hazardous positions.
A chain may be used as a physical barrier or for securing equipment, but it does not provide the necessary fall protection for employees leaning over an edge. Chains do not have the capability to arrest a fall, rendering them ineffective as a safety measure in this context.
A gate serves to control access to certain areas but does not offer any protection against falls. While it can enhance safety by restricting entry to hazardous zones, it does not prevent an employee from leaning out over an edge or falling, thus failing to meet the requirements of a fall protection system.
In a hoist area where employees may lean out over edges, a fall arrest system is imperative for safety. This system is designed to prevent injuries from falls, which is crucial in high-risk scenarios. Other options, such as control lines, chains, or gates, do not provide the necessary protective measures, underscoring the importance of implementing a fall arrest system in such environments.
